Jung-uk Kim
7e38239042
MFV: r362286
...
Merge flex 2.6.4.
2020-06-18 18:09:16 +00:00
Marcelo Araujo
c81a92db98
Use NULL instead of 0 for pointers.
...
realloc will return NULL in case it cannot allocate memory.
MFC after: 2 weeks.
2016-04-19 02:05:32 +00:00
Jung-uk Kim
ab76bc977a
Connect flex 2.5.37 to the build and bump __FreeBSD_version.
2013-05-21 19:32:35 +00:00
Baptiste Daroussin
6916e47018
import vanilla flex version 2.5.35
...
Reviewed by: cognet
Approved by: cognet
2011-11-28 14:58:51 +00:00
Ulrich Spörlein
91109a91ba
Unbreak the test target by re-generating the initial scanner
...
using an updated flex(1) binary.
Also ignore the changing $FreeBSD$ ID lines when doing the diff.
This needs additional obfuscation, to not upset the svn precommit
hooks :/
2010-11-09 18:28:11 +00:00
Ed Schouten
a6c287f615
Let both yacc and lex generate code that passes -Wold-style-definition.
...
Both these tools emit code where several functions have no `void'
keyword placed in the arugment list when the function has no arguments.
2009-12-30 22:46:08 +00:00
David Malone
48f6b9b8b1
De-register declarations.
2008-06-04 19:50:34 +00:00
Philippe Charnier
93b0017f88
Replace various spelling with FALLTHROUGH which is lint()able
2002-08-25 13:23:09 +00:00
David E. O'Brien
e026a48c34
Consistently use FBSDID
2002-06-30 05:25:07 +00:00
Ruslan Ermilov
8af1452cf8
Removed duplicate VCS ID tags, as per style(9).
2001-08-13 14:06:34 +00:00
David E. O'Brien
2db7675cc2
After a proper import we now have both the original RCS tags + our own.
...
(also now clearer in ``cvs log'' that we are at version 2.5.4)
1999-10-27 07:56:49 +00:00
David E. O'Brien
112e4e871c
Virgin import of Flex v2.5.4
1999-10-27 07:34:55 +00:00
Peter Wemm
a1a4f1a0d8
$Header$ -> $FreeBSD$
1999-08-28 05:11:36 +00:00
Steve Price
398b39b912
Upgrade to version 2.5.4 of flex.
...
Inspired by: NetBSD/OpenBSD (I can't remember who I saw do it
first, so I'll give them both some inspiration
points. :)
1996-12-14 05:48:48 +00:00
Nate Williams
693e59976b
Finish the import and merge in FreeBSD specific changes.
...
Add a 'bootstrap' target which *must* be run before building the new
version, since the new scanner relies on the current version of flex to
build itself otherwise.
1996-06-19 20:48:06 +00:00
Nate Williams
0a985cc317
Flex version 2.5.3 from Vern Paxson at LBL.
1996-06-19 20:26:48 +00:00
Rodney W. Grimes
7799f52a32
Remove trailing whitespace.
1995-05-30 06:41:30 +00:00
Geoff Rehmet
8387c24d79
Flex version 2.4.7 from LBL
...
Reviewed by: Geoff.
1994-08-24 13:10:34 +00:00